European Union to disburse 200 million euros for Albania and Montenegro, says Kos

TIRANA, May 11 – European Union Commissioner for Enlargement Marta Kos said the European Union will disburse 200 million euros for Albania and Montenegro under the Growth Plan.

Meanwhile, she stated that implementation of the Growth Plan is progressing well. She confirmed that nearly 200 million euros will be released in the coming days for both countries. The process already produces concrete results in gradual integration, she added.

In a regional context, Kos referred to recent developments and noted that Serbia joined Albania, Montenegro and North Macedonia in SEPA last week.

At the same time, she announced preparations for the European Union–Western Balkans summit in Podgorica on June 5. She said she expects strong commitment from Western Balkans candidates to remain firmly on the European path.
